Smoked Anchovy Cheek
Smoked anchovy cheeks are a delicacy known for their rich flavor and high protein content. They are often used in Mediterranean cuisine and are prized for their umami taste.
•Rich in omega-3 fatty acids, which are essential for heart health and reducing inflammation.
•High protein content supports muscle repair and growth, making it ideal for athletes.
Fresh Abalone
Fresh abalone is a highly prized seafood known for its tender texture and rich flavor. It is a source of high-quality protein and essential nutrients.
•Rich in protein, fresh abalone provides essential amino acids necessary for muscle repair and growth.
•Contains high levels of vitamin B12, which is crucial for nerve function and the production of DNA and red blood cells.
